Subject: Quickstore 4.2 — bloom filter now fronts the KV layer

Plugin authors: starting with this release, Quickstore places a bloom filter ahead of the key-value store. Negative lookups return faster; false positives fall through safely. No API changes are required on your side. Verify your plugin against the staging build referenced below.

session token of fahif-tadup = htk3_9c7

Facilities Ticket — Cleaning Crew Access, Brindle Annex

For new starters handling evening lock-up: the Sorano Cleaning crew arrives nightly at 21:30 via the annex side door. Check their rota sheet, note arrival in the log, and ensure the storeroom is relocked afterward. To let them through the side door, enter the access code below.

badge for yaweg-hafog: bdg-GX-6

Q: How do I get into the first-aid room?

A: The first-aid room is on the ground floor of the Maplin Building, opposite the lift lobby. It stays locked outside staffed hours. In an emergency, call the duty first-aider first; do not move an injured person yourself. Supplies inside are logged — note anything you use on the wall sheet. Restock requests go to facilities. For access outside staffed hours, the door keypad is active around the clock. Enter the code below.

door code, kawip-bagap: bdg-HQEWH-4

## Deployment

Heads up, on-call: Florin-Exchange is touchy about rounding. We round half-even at conversion time and reconcile drift nightly; if the drift job flags more than a few millicents per batch, roll back first and ask questions later. Before deploying, confirm the service is running with the following configuration values:

service settings:
[briius]
port = 3000
region = outer-1
host = briius.zarqeldyn.internal
team = wenael
timeout_ms = 2000
retries = 5